Built a homemade quad out of 5/8" poplar and hobby ply. It's an 850. Running one of the $69 Mega boards with a Free IMU .35 BMP. 10x4.5 props(balanced) on SK 3530 1100Kv motors. FC is very well isolated and there are only the slighest of vibrations. Running MW 2.1 with default PIDs. RCTimer 30A's flashed with SimonK code & calibrated. Does the same in Gyro Mode or Acc mode. It will hover and it is a stable hover....Except: If I don't stay on the throttle, it pulses, severly. It will pulse it's way into a low Earth orbit if I let it. I also seems to "Spaz out" every once and a while too. That is it seems to jerk about suddenly but, only for a brief period and only small movements. You would think Vibrations! but no. I even tried enabling progressivly lower filters but it did not help. Lowered PIDs too, no change. Any ideas? This is the first time I have used this FC, I'm going to slap a know good Crius SE on it just to make sure the frame is not the cause.

Well, tried A Crius SE and it made no noticable improvement. Had 2 other incidents where the quad just sort of did its own thing regardless of my control inputs. The 2nd incident was fatal. Electronics now live on a homemade H quad and seem to perform much better. Perhaps the frame was the cause but, I will never know.
